How ISRG's Strategic Manipulation of Surgical Data Reshapes AI in Medicine—Latest Analyst Quotes Reveal the Bigger Picture

The third quarter of 2025 marked a pivotal moment for Intuitive Surgical, as management’s commentary unveiled a transformation that extends far beyond traditional robotics. While da Vinci 5 appears as a hardware upgrade on the surface, it fundamentally represents a strategic manipulation of surgical workflows through an advanced digital infrastructure. The system’s 10,000-fold increase in computational capacity compared to earlier generations enables continuous collection and analysis of surgical data across multiple modalities—video feeds, kinematic movements, force measurements, and where applicable, electronic medical records. This multimodal dataset forms the foundation of a centralized analytics engine that processes intraoperative information and delivers actionable insights back to surgical teams.

da Vinci 5’s Computational Capabilities: Technical Manipulation Enables Real-Time Intelligence

The architecture underpinning da Vinci 5 centers on the integrated Hub, designed to capture and transmit large volumes of intraoperative video data. According to recent quotes from CEO Dave Rosa, the company’s progression begins with “really good data” and advances toward increasingly sophisticated AI and machine learning applications. The system’s latest software updates—including Force Gauge, Focus Mode, in-console video replay, and 3D model manipulation capabilities—are explicitly engineered to enhance surgeon awareness and enable real-time decision-making during procedures.

Management explicitly framed these features not merely as incremental improvements but as stepping stones toward real-time intraoperative guidance delivered at the point of care, rather than post-procedure analytics. By applying advanced algorithms to aggregated surgical datasets, Intuitive Surgical envisions delivering AI-driven operational guidance and what analysts describe as “augmented dexterity”—essentially, intelligent systems that help surgeons and care teams optimize clinical outcomes, procedural efficiency, and economic performance.

What distinguishes ISRG’s approach is its longer-term strategic arc: the company is potentially evolving from a pure-play robotics manufacturer into a surgical data intelligence enterprise. If execution proceeds as outlined, the data architecture embedded in da Vinci 5 could enable Intuitive Surgical to monetize insights alongside instruments and systems, fundamentally reshaping the company’s revenue model.

Competitive Landscape: How Peer Companies’ Strategic Quotes Inform the AI Medical Device Race

The broader medical device sector is rapidly incorporating AI into operational workflows. Two notable competitors—GE HealthCare and Boston Scientific—have publicly outlined ambitious AI strategies in recent quotes and presentations.

Boston Scientific has positioned AI as a core competitive differentiator across its electrophysiology and cardiac mapping ecosystem. The company highlighted integration of its OPAL HDx mapping system with the Cortex AI algorithm, designed to better visualize and target irregular rhythm sources, particularly in cases of persistent atrial fibrillation. Management emphasized that AI-enabled workflow simplification is driving higher adoption of FARAPULSE and more reproducible procedural outcomes. In recent quotes, Boston Scientific framed its AI investments as software-led enhancements that improve procedural precision, compress ablation workflows, and expand the addressable patient population.

GE HealthCare, meanwhile, positioned AI as central to its “precision care” strategic vision, embedding intelligence across imaging hardware, cloud platforms, and digital workflows. The company demonstrated strong uptake of AI-enabled products in Advanced Visualization Solutions, including AI-powered ultrasound platforms and interventional imaging systems with onboard computational intelligence. GE HealthCare’s portfolio extends to SaaS offerings like CareIntellect, which delivers real-time clinical insights alongside AI-driven tools supporting cardiology, radiology, and perinatal care. Management noted that GE HealthCare’s AI portfolio functions not as standalone software but as tightly integrated components with imaging devices and data ecosystems, driving both growth and margin expansion.

Stock Valuation and Recent Analyst Quotes: Contextualizing ISRG’s Market Position

From a performance standpoint, ISRG shares gained 3.6% over the preceding six-month period, underperforming the broader medical device industry’s 12.2% advance. Valuation metrics reveal a forward price-to-earnings ratio of 55.23, above the industry median but notably lower than ISRG’s five-year median of 71.51. The stock carries a Zacks Value Score of D, reflecting elevated valuation relative to fundamental metrics.

Recent analyst quotes embedded in Zacks Consensus Estimates suggest ISRG’s 2026 earnings are expected to expand 11.1% compared to the prior-year period. The stock maintains a Zacks Rank of #2 (Buy), indicating analyst confidence despite the premium valuation.

The persistent premium valuation reflects market recognition of ISRG’s unique positioning. Investors appear willing to price in the strategic pivot toward surgical data intelligence, recognizing that da Vinci 5’s data architecture could unlock new revenue streams and competitive moats over the medium to long term. Whether the company successfully executes on this vision—converting surgical insights into differentiated customer value—will ultimately determine whether current valuations prove justified or represent inflated expectations.
